Rif Hutton

Birthday: 1962-11-28 | Place of Birth: San Antonio, Texas, USA

Rif Hutton (born November 28, 1962) is an American actor. He appeared in several soap operas and television guest roles before landing recurring roles as Dr. Ron Welch in the comedy-drama series Doogie Howser, M.D. (1990 - 1993) and as Lt. Cmdr. Alan Mattoni on the series JAG (1997 - 2001). Hutton has continued to appear in numerous screen roles and provided additional voices in many animated films. Hutton is also notable for playing Russ Beeler, a fictional owner of a KFC establishment, appearing in a number of KFC commercials in the early to mid 1990s. He has been married to voice actress Bridget Hoffman since 2001.
